Punta Arenas is our home for a few days. The ferry from Puerto Natales to Puerto Yungay only runs once per week departing on Thursdays at 5am. We need to be on the boat Wednesday about 9pm. So we'll hunker down here for some rest and relaxation. The hospitality at Zivko's house made me feel as welcome as anywhere I've ever been. Zivko wasn't happy that I moved to a hotel, but I needed some time alone. Albin also moved to a hotel for R&R. 

Matias and I went to Isla Magdalena to see the penguins. We took a boat out to the island and then spent an hour walking through the preserve. They estimate that there are 4,000 penguins here. The word in Spanish is pengüino, yes with a ü. The ü is pronounced with a "we" sound. For example, we stayed in Malargüe - pronounced ma-lar-way.

I took some time to handle some errands and enjoy the local cultural activities. The military came out to raise the flag and some dancers demonstrated the national dance - the cueca. I made sure the kiss the foot at Magellan at the town square. This is a tradition which signifies that you will return again!
